## Changelog 2.8 — WageSpindle export

The payroll export switched from fixed-width to the new columnar format, and the setting formerly named `EXPORT_KEY` was renamed accordingly. Release managers: the exporter validates the renamed secret at startup, so before tagging the release, update each env file so the secret sits on the next line:

sealed setting: ARCHIVE_KEY3=8d0

Handover — FixtureForge

Taking over test-data factory duties. Library lives in the Quillbrook monorepo under /libs/fixtureforge. Seed generation is deterministic per branch; if CI fixtures diverge, bump the seed epoch and rerun. Nightly purge job is flaky — restart it manually if it hangs past 02:00. Don't touch the schema templates without pinging the Datum guild. Current runtime settings are as follows.

deployment values, yadug-bawif:
[framir]
team = pelox
access_code = ac_a38ab2
owner = tamion.julael
host = framir.tolvaqlabs.test
port = 11211
peer = tammir.zemvargrid.local
salt = 2215ef03
pin = 1541

# Provenance: Lattice Component Library

Lattice versions follow strict semver. Support team: do not guess versions from screenshots. Every consuming app exposes the embedded Lattice manifest at the diagnostics endpoint. Builds outside the Fernwald pipeline are unsupported — close those tickets with the standard macro. When escalating, attach the provenance token shown below.

build token for tawip-yageg: htk9_92ac43d42